The Silence of Acceptance…
- Cassandra Daneluscu
- Oct 30, 2022
- 1 min read
When silence is painful,
we speak to fill it.
We might speak too much,
we might wish we didn’t.
To ignore or submerge,
our thoughts, prayers, and wishes,
pushed aside in dirty water
like piles of dirty dishes.
Silence is necessary;
few listen to empty
their head of thoughts
replaced by fake-smiles-a-plenty.
When the thoughts pool,
we have time to just sit
too little too late,
though no one will say it.
Loud thoughts in our heads
keep our mouths motionless,
as the silence of acceptance
sounds like a roar; quite ferocious.
